If I am not mistaken, the interface in the Ultrabay slot in the T6x and X6x series was PATA, meaning that if you e.g. were using a 2nd SATA Ultrabay Adapter, the adapter actually contained a SATA-to-PATA converter.
Also, the optical devices used in the T6x and X6x series were PATA.
The Montevina Thinkpads seem to be native SATA in the Ultrabay slots.
If the above is correct, you should not be able to use any T6x or X6x Ultrabay adapter or optical drive in a new Montevina Thinkpad and vice versa.
